G17fan Posted March 4, 2012 Share Posted March 4, 2012 I have a standard 8 rounder without the basepad.... Can I install a base pad to it by removing the bottom plate? It looks like it is tack welded.... I looked on his websire under FAQ and nothing about this.... Thanks.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
kmca Posted March 4, 2012 Share Posted March 4, 2012 You don't need to do that. There are kits available with a drill jig and base pads. Simply drill the base and put in the enclosed self-threading screws.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
